There are some restrictions to have both GPRS-only and EGPRS MS attached to the same MS: * Any MS needs to be able to successfully decode a DL block at least every 18 DL blocks (360 ms). That means a Dl block with CS1-4 must be sent at least once during that time. * Any MS needs to be able to decode USF targeting it. GPRS-only MS can successfully decode USF from DL blocks using GMSK: CS1-4 and MCS1-4. In this patch, if USF of a GPRS-only MS is selected, then all DL EGPRS TBFs are discarded from data block selection. However, this logic can be further improved later by still allowing selection of DL EGPRS TBFs and then forcing construction of a DL EGPRS data block using MCS1-4. Sources: * 3GPP TS 03.64 version 8.12.0 "6.6.4.1.1.2 Multiplexing of GPRS and EGPRS MSs" * 3GPP TS 05.08 version 8.23.0 "10.2.2 BTS output power" Related: OS#4544 Change-Id: Ib4991c864eda6864533363443f76ae5d999532ae |

osmo-pcu - Osmocom Packet Control Unit
This repository contains a C/C++-language implementation of a GPRS Packet Control Unit, as specified by ETSI/3GPP. It is part of the Osmocom Open Source Mobile Communications project.
The Packet Control Unit is terminating the Layer 2 (RLC/MAC) of the GPRS radio interface and adapting it to the Gb Interface (BSSGP+NS Protocol) towards the SGSN.
The PCU interfaces with the physical layer of the radio interface. OsmoPCU is typically used co-located with the BTS, specifically OsmoBTS. For legacy BTSs that run proprietary sotware without an interface to OsmoPCU, you may also co-locate it with the BSC, specifically OsmoBSC

Documentation
We provide a user manual as well as a vty reference manual
Please note that a lot of the PCU configuration actually happens inside the BSC, which passes this configuration via A-bis OML to the BTS, which then in turn passes it via the PCU socket into OsmoPCU.

Current limitations
- No PFC support
- No fixed allocation support (was removed from 3GPP Rel >= 5 anyway)
- No extended dynamic allocation support
- No unacknowledged mode operation
- Only single slot assignment on uplink direction
- No half-duplex class support (only semi-duplex)
- No TA loop
- No power loop
